** NOTE ON CPR GUIDELINES **

Current CPR guidelines from the American Red Cross (ARC) and American Heart Association (AHA) may not agree with what is found in the current editions of the BSA First Aid Merit Badge pamphlet.   The AHA and ARC guidelines were updated in November / December 2005 based on new research; updates to the BSA pamphlets may trail these advances by several years.   In the interest of fairness, EITHER SET OF CPR CHEST COMPRESSIONS / RESCUE BREATHS GUIDELINES WILL BE ACCEPTED!   That is, either the guidelines found in the First Aid MB pamphlet (15/2) or those currently adopted by the ARC / AHA organizations (30/2) will be accepted by the judges at the First Aid Meet.
